The Short Take
Borsao Tres Picos is 100% Garnacha from 30-65 year old head-pruned vines on the slopes of an extinct volcano in Aragón. Dark cherry, roasted plum, cedar, chocolate, and violet with downy tannins. Consistently 90+ points at $16. One of Spain's greatest everyday values.
Campo de Borja is not Rioja. Nobody is talking about it at dinner parties. That is precisely why the value here is absurd. Old-vine Garnacha — some of these vines are 65 years old, head-pruned on volcanic soil at altitude — and they are charging $16 for it.
Dark cherry, roasted plum, cedar, milk chocolate, espresso, violet. More delicate and floral than you would expect from old-vine anything. The tannins are downy and ripe. It is full-bodied but not heavy — there is a freshness from the altitude that keeps it moving.
